AWS Lambda
is commonly being used together with other AWS Services such asDynamoDB
,S3
andSQS
.- Conventional
Python
Unit Testing is not sufficient to perform unit test onAWS Lambda Python
as it requires integration with AWS Services.
- Provides an example how AWS Services (e.g. DynamoDB) can be mocked to allow Unit Testing on
AWS Lambda Python
. - Provides an example how
AWS CDK
is used together in this project as demostration ofIAC
together withAWS Lambda Python
Source Code.
requirements-test.txt
pytest==6.2.5
pytest-cov==3.0.0
pytest-mock==3.8.2
requests-mock==1.10.0
moto[all]==4.0.1
python3 -m pytest lambda/functions_tests/*/test_*.py --capture=sys --cov=lambda/functions --cov-fail-under=95 --cov-report=term-missing
The cdk.json
file tells the CDK Toolkit how to execute your app.
This project is set up like a standard Python project. The initialization
process also creates a virtualenv within this project, stored under the .venv
directory. To create the virtualenv it assumes that there is a python3
(or python
for Windows) executable in your path with access to the venv
package. If for any reason the automatic creation of the virtualenv fails,
you can create the virtualenv manually.
To manually create a virtualenv on MacOS and Linux:
$ python3 -m venv .venv
After the init process completes and the virtualenv is created, you can use the following step to activate your virtualenv.
$ source .venv/bin/activate
If you are a Windows platform, you would activate the virtualenv like this:
% .venv\Scripts\activate.bat
Once the virtualenv is activated, you can install the required dependencies.
$ pip install -r requirements.txt
At this point you can now synthesize the CloudFormation template for this code.
$ cdk synth
To add additional dependencies, for example other CDK libraries, just add
them to your setup.py
file and rerun the pip install -r requirements.txt
command.
